Key Factors to Consider Before Investing in Dammam Real Estate

Investing in real estate can be a lucrative venture, especially in growing markets like Dammam. Situated on Saudi Arabia's eastern coast, Dammam is experiencing rapid development, making it an attractive option for both local and foreign investors. However, before diving into the real estate market in Dammam, there are several key factors to consider.

1. Market Research
Before making any investment, thorough market research is essential. Analyze current market trends, property values, and demand for different types of properties. Understanding the neighborhood dynamics, commercial versus residential demands, and future developments will help you make informed decisions. Market reports and local real estate agents can provide valuable insights into what areas are poised for growth.

2. Location, Location, Location
The location of a property significantly impacts its investment potential. In Dammam, proximity to key amenities such as schools, shopping centers, hospitals, and public transportation can enhance property value. Areas like the Corniche, which offer scenic views and recreational facilities, are often more desirable. Ensure that you assess different neighborhoods to find the most strategic location for your investment.

3. Regulatory Environment
Saudi Arabia has specific laws and regulations regarding property ownership, particularly for foreign investors. It is vital to understand these regulations, including ownership rights and restrictions. Engaging with a legal expert familiar with the Saudi real estate market can help avoid legal pitfalls and ensure compliance with local laws.

4. Economic Factors
Dammam's economy plays a crucial role in shaping the real estate market. Factors such as job growth, population increase, and infrastructural development will directly impact property values. The government’s Vision 2030 initiative aims to diversify the economy, which could lead to increased real estate demand. Keeping an eye on economic indicators will help you anticipate market movements and make better investment decisions.

5. Investment Purpose
Clearly defining your investment purpose is crucial. Are you looking for a property to generate rental income, or are you considering long-term appreciation? Different objectives might lead to different types of properties or locations. For example, if rental income is your goal, investing near universities or business districts might be ideal due to the expected influx of tenants.

6. Financing Options
Understanding your financing options is essential before investing in Dammam real estate. Investigate mortgage rates, potential return on investment, and the overall cost of ownership, including taxes and maintenance fees. Explore local banks or international financial institutions that offer loans to property buyers in Saudi Arabia. Comparing financing options can offer significant savings over time.

7. Future Development Plans
As a rapidly growing city, Dammam is witnessing various large-scale development projects. Check with local authorities about any future infrastructure or commercial developments. Projects such as new roads, malls, and recreational areas can positively affect property value. Being aware of these plans can provide an opportunity for lucrative investments ahead of the curve.

8. Local Amenities and Community
Buyers and tenants often prioritize access to local amenities and a vibrant community. Properties near parks, restaurants, and cultural attractions tend to attract more interest. Assessing the social and cultural aspects of different neighborhoods can also enhance your investment appeal.

9. Professional Assistance
Consider engaging a local real estate expert or consultant who understands the Dammam market. Their experience can guide you through the buying process, offer insights on valuable investment opportunities, and help with negotiations. Having a professional in your corner can save you time and money, ensuring a smoother experience.

10. Exit Strategy
No investment is complete without a clear exit strategy. Before purchasing real estate in Dammam, it is essential to outline under what conditions you would sell your property. This might include market conditions, personal needs, or financial goals. Having a well-thought-out exit plan can help you navigate the real estate market more effectively.
